Mississippi River Pool 18 Map, Recycled Nylon Fabric, Marcus And Morgan Luttrell Tattoo, Valley Cartage Tracking, Told Meaning In Kannada, 3 Seater Van Reviews, Simple Man Shinedown Chords, Pandas To Csv, " />

A dictionary can contain another dictionary, which in turn can contain dictionaries themselves, and so on to arbitrary depth. As such, it can be indexed, sliced, and changed. While this works, it's clutter you can do without. Sample Solution: Python … Initialize a variable to a nested list. Create a Nested List. Nested dictionaries are one of many ways to represent structured information (similar to ‘records’ or ‘structs’ in other languages). Graph and its representations. How to Implement Breadth-First Search. This is known as nested dictionary. Python Fiddle Python Cloud IDE ... Python Cloud IDE. It is Oanda API candle data that looks like this: For each 'get' of the data, the order of the li Flatten a nested dictionary. ... value, to be found, can be anywhere, so within a nested dictionary in a nested dictionary in a list, but also within a list within a nested dictionary or just a list. Pass the list … List comprehensions offer smart way to create lists based on existing lists. Photo credit to MagiDeal Traditional recursive python solution for flattening JSON. This is a recipe to flatten a Python list which may have nested lists as items within it. In this tutorial, we will learn how to flat a nested list using a couple of different approaches. A list is a mutable, ordered sequence of items. With for and update We take an empty dictionary and add elements to it by reading the elements from the list. to flatten a list of lists; to create a list of lists; to iterate over a list of lists; Additionally, you’ll learn how to apply nested list comprehension. del is written like a Python break statement, on its own line, followed by the item in the dictionary that you want to delete. Flattening lists means converting a multidimensional or nested list into a one-dimensional list. For example, the process of converting this [[1,2], [3,4]] list to [1,2,3,4] is called flattening. Trees and Tree Algorithms. If the value is found more than once, I also want to know the name of the dictionary to which it belongs. Flatten a nested list of lists. 中文. Flatten a nested dictionary. To delete an item stored in a nested dictionary, we can use the del statement. The same applies to your agenda, where you can modify the order in which you do things and even reschedule a number of tasks for the next day if needed. The following fu n ction is an example of flattening JSON recursively. Python: Flatten a given nested list structure Last update on October 08 2020 09:22:31 (UTC/GMT +8 hours) Python List: Exercise - 72 with Solution. Graphs in Python. 'F' means to flatten in column-major (Fortran- style) order. Nested lists are lists holding other lists as its elements. Flatten list or nested list comprehension in python, Nested list is nothing but a multiple list within a single list. I found that there were some nested json. If we want to store information in a structured way, creating a nested dictionary in python … Although there are many ways to flatten a dictionary, I think this way is particularly elegant. Breadth First Search. So let’s get started! ... How to add new keys to a dictionary in Python; How to pass a variable by reference in Python; Check if a … I just want to try it out. character. Proposals for a flatten function to be added to the standard library appear from time to time on python-dev and python-ideas mailing lists. Basically the same way you would flatten a nested list, you just have to do the extra work for iterating the dict by key/value, creating new keys for your new dictionary and creating the dictionary at final step. A nested list is a list within a list. Write a Python program to flatten a given nested list structure. Fortunately, in Python, there are many ways to achieve this. A nested list is nothing but a list containing several lists for example [1,2,[3],[4,[5,6]] Often we need to convert these nested list into a flat list to perform regular list operations on the data. Correspondingly, how do you flatten a list in recursion in Python? Problem: Given a list of lists. Language English. Each element can be accessed using its position in the list. Convert nested lists to dictionary in python, Try this: result_group = {} group_count = 0 for sub_group in result: first_rel_item = 0 result_group[group_count] How to convert the above nested list into a dictionary where, for example, lst[0][0] will be the dictionary key, and … Is there a better way of creating a nested dictionary than what I'm doing below? ... Count set bits using Python List comprehension; Python Dictionary Comprehension; ... We can also take a nested list and flatten it by creating a single list without having any sub-list … Regarding the alleged duplicate of Flatten a dictionary of dictionaries (2 levels deep) of lists in Python: … Flatten 2D list (a list of lists) itertools.chain.from_iterable() sum() Speed; Flatten 3D or higher lists and irregular lists ... Browse other questions tagged python python-3.x dictionary or ask your own question. Flatten nested Python dictionaries, compressing keys ... Basically the same way you would flatten a nested list, you just have to do the extra work for iterating the dict by key/value, creating new keys for your new dictionary and creating the dictionary … What is Python Nested Dictionary? Here is what I have and it works fine: Traverse A Tree. Graph and its representations. Flattening is an operation where we take a list of nested lists and convert it into a different data structure that contains no nested lists. Please note that I know Python is not a promoter for functional programming. flatten.py from copy import deepcopy: def flatten_list (nested_list): """Flatten an arbitrarily nested list, without recursion (to avoid: stack overflows). Tuples… It works for lists that have a maximum depth of nesting roughly equal to the recursion depth limit of Python, which is set to 1000 by default, though it can be increased with sys.setrecursionlimit(). ... Would flatten the dictionary … Run Reset Share Import Link. Python Flatten List (Shallow Flattening) Python Flatten List (Deep Flattening) We will learn how to flatten a nested list in Python, in layman language, flatten a list of lists in Python. Phyton python flatten nested list,python flatten nested dictionary,python flatten I am trying to load the json file to pandas data frame. A list can contain any sort object, even another list (sublist), which in turn can contain sublists themselves, and so on. Python developers usually respond with the following points: A one-level flatten (turning an iterable of iterables into a single iterable) is a trivial one-line expression (x for y in z for x in y) and in … ... We are creating a new dictionary to save the flatten dictionary. This is known as nested list.. You can use them to arrange data into hierarchical structures. Nested Dictionary Python: Delete Element. Flatten dictionary in Python (functional style) 2. Returns a new list, the original list … Embed. How to Implement Breadth-First Search. Values of the first list will be the key to the dictionary and corresponding values of the second list will be the value of the dictionary.

Mississippi River Pool 18 Map, Recycled Nylon Fabric, Marcus And Morgan Luttrell Tattoo, Valley Cartage Tracking, Told Meaning In Kannada, 3 Seater Van Reviews, Simple Man Shinedown Chords, Pandas To Csv,

Categories: Uncategorized

Leave a Reply

Your email address will not be published. Required fields are marked *